Next level banoffee pie
Next level banoffee pie
20 min8 servings

Take this classic dessert to the next level with our marvellous makeover, featuring salted caramel, banana chips, crushed biscuits and peanut butter cream

Ingredients
262g pack dark chocolate oat biscuits (we used Hobnobs)
65g butter melted
4 slightly overripe bananas
4 tbsp light brown soft sugar
1 lime juiced
397g tin Carnation caramel
80g banana chips crushed
100g smooth peanut butter
100g icing sugar
340ml double cream
Instructions
1 Whizz the biscuits to crumbs in a food processor or put in a strong plastic bag and bash with a rolling pin. Add the butter and whizz again briefly, then tip the buttery crumbs into a 22cm fluted tart tin. Use the back of a spoon to press the crumbs into the tin and up the sides until the whole case is lined. Chill for at least 10 mins.
2 Heat oven to 200C/180C fan/gas 8. Halve the bananas lengthways and tip into a shallow roasting tray or baking dish. Squeeze over the lime juice, scatter with the brown sugar and bake in the oven for 15-20 mins until caramelised. Leave to cool slightly, then thoroughly mash and spread evenly over the tart base.
3 Tip the caramel into a saucepan, bring to a simmer and bubble for a few minutes to thicken. Add a pinch of flaky sea salt. Crush the banana chips using a rolling pin on a chopping board. Take the pan off the heat and stir in most of the banana chips, then spread the mixture over the banana layer and put back in the fridge for at least 4 hrs to set.
4 To make the peanut butter cream, beat the peanut butter with the icing sugar and 140ml of the cream until smooth. Whisk the rest of the cream until it just holds its shape, then fold through the peanut butter cream to ripple. Top the tart with pillows of the whipped cream. Scatter with the rest of the crushed banana chips and serve.
